People Picker control not available
Hi there,
I've got a problem with the people picker control in a SharePoint Server 2007 task list. The "Assigned To" field is not displayed for some users (unregarding if they are editing an existing item where already a person is assigned or creating a new item
in the list). Other people can use the field just as they should be able to. All have the same rights on the list, but I don't think it's a SharePoint permission problem.
The item is displayed fully and on the left there is the "Assigned to" title in the row, but on the right where the people picker field should appear there is a message saying, that the control is not available due to missing permissions.
Now the people picker is an ActiveX control if I'm right. But as I'm also a user of Project Server 2007 and am able to install and use the Project ActiveX controls with no problem at all. So there shouldn't be a problem with my IE settings concerning ActiveX.
Can you give me a hint to where to start my error search?
Thanks!
Update: Don't know if it's important: If I let someone who can see the assigned to field log on to SharePoint with his user, the field is also displayed. As soon as the user is switched back to me, the error occurs again.

This could happen if the user does not have Browse User Information permissions and the edit form picker control is already populated with a user.
Compare a user who does not experience this problem to another and see if they have more permissions outside the list than the problematic user.Fred Ellis - MSFT
